Re: Panzer kaput! Tamiya Tiger 1 restoration.
Posted: Fri Oct 08, 2021 12:19 pm
by jarndice
Do be careful what you order because there are a number of different versions of the hatches on sale,
Some have a multitude of parts to make the hinge, The pictured item is exactly correct,
If you are fitting periscopes to the hatches I would do it before gluing the hatches in place.
